At an early age, I knew I wanted to pursue a career in medical sales. My mom was a single mother, and when I was five years old, went back to school so she could provide a better life for us. I witnessed my mom's grit and resilience to go from barely making ends meet, living paycheck to paycheck, to climb the corporate ladder, and become a respected regional sales manager for a Fortune 100 pharmaceutical company.
She modeled determination and perseverance. In my early years, I dreamed of pursuing a career in medical sales. At 23 years old, I started my first medical sales job in the dental industry, and within five years earned four consecutive awards for President's Club, then moved on to another company and let a sales team to number one in the nation.
In 2020, I faced a series of life-changing events that left me feeling confused, discouraged, and uncertain about my future. 2020 started off with my husband. When he came back after a year of deployment in Iraq. We felt immense gratitude for his safe return. Especially considering that just a few weeks before coming home, his hit was targeted by the enemy with a barrage of over 13 missiles in one day.
However, transitioning back into the family life proved to be more challenging than we had anticipated Having just returned from a war zone, he was met with the site of our three-year-old twins throwing tantrums. Over something as trivial as not having enough jelly on their sandwiches. The contrast between the intensity of his experience abroad and the everyday struggles at home was stark and it required patience and adjustment from all of us as we navigated this next chapter.
Next, on March 8th, I tragically lost my mother to suicide. Adding to the sorrow the day just before I was set to fly out for her celebration of life. The global pandemic forced widespread lockdowns, abruptly shutting down the world and preventing anyone from traveling or gathering. And many of you know what that was like.
Admits these challenging times. The company I had dedicated seven years of my life to was acquired and that once familiar culture began to shift, unfortunately as the case with many organizations, certain individuals with negative attitudes were not addressed promptly sending a message that such behavior was acceptable.
This toxicity quickly spread like wildfire, tarnishing the work environment. Regrettably, the atmosphere deteriorated to a point where several of us who had been loyal to the company for a decade or even two decades, made the difficult decision to leave this week. Sequence of events propelled me onto a journey of self-discovery, prompting me to redefine my understanding of success.
I realized that success wasn't solely defined by job titles and awards, but by the positive impact I can make on the world, helping others bounce back from setbacks and develop the grit and resilience to thrive in all areas of their life, fueled by this realization, and in response.
